EP 28 PROTECT:
Custom solution for combustible metal grinding dust
The EVOTEC EP 28 PROTECT was developed as a custom solution for extracting flammable, potentially explosive grinding dust from metal . The system is used in a grinding process for turbine wheels and combines high-performance extraction technology with comprehensive safety features – including an automatic extinguishing system, flameless pressure relief, volume flow control, fill level monitoring, and controlled filter cleaning.

Industrial grinding processes generate very fine dust—some of which is potentially explosive—depending on the material .
Standard solutions are often insufficient, particularly when dealing with metallic grinding dust, since, in addition to simply capturing the dust, it is also necessary to protect operators, machinery, and the production environment.
For a customer in the turbine machining sector, the EVOTEC EP 28 PROTECT was developed as a custom solution. The system is designed for the safe extraction of flammable metal grinding dust and is used directly in a grinding process for turbine blades.
The focus was on three requirements:
- Reliable data collection during the process
- a high level of operational reliability in a live production environment and
- A multi-level safety concept for explosion protection.
Customized Exhaust Solution for Zone 22
The EVOTEC EP 28 PROTECT was designed for safe use in ATEX Zone 22.
The system is not a standard machine from a catalog, but rather a custom design developed specifically for this project, featuring specially configured safety and control components.
Especially when dealing with flammable metal dusts, simply increasing the suction power is not enough.
The key lies in the interplay between detection, filtration technology, monitoring, pressure relief, fire suppression systems, and control.
Only when these components are tailored to the specific process can a solution be created that functions safely and reliably in everyday industrial operations .

Integrated Fire Suppression System
Automatic and manual fire suppression system with dry chemical powder
A key safety feature of the system is the integrated D-powder fire suppression system. It is specifically designed for the material being extracted and the associated fire hazards posed by combustible metal dusts.
In the event of a fire, the fire suppression system is automatically activated by the system control unit. At the same time, the system is shut down in a controlled manner to ensure that the process is safely interrupted and that no further movement of air or dust exacerbates the hazardous situation. The fire suppression system, sensors, control system, and shutdown logic are all coordinated to form a unified safety concept.
In addition, a manual activation feature is provided. This allows the fire suppression system to be activated directly at the system itself, independently of the automatic system, if a situation on site requires immediate action.
Flameless pressure relief to protect equipment and production
A key safety feature is the side-mounted flameless pressure relief system. It is designed so that, in the event of an incident, the resulting explosion pressure can be safely vented from inside the system without allowing flames to escape uncontrolled into the production area.
A rupture disc is used inside the system. If a specified pressure is exceeded, the rupture disc opens and allows pressure to be relieved. The resulting pressure is then vented via the flameless pressure relief element. This component is designed to specifically reduce both pressure and the effects of flames before they are released into the surrounding area.
One notable feature is its lateral positioning on the separate support frame. This design was deliberately chosen to ensure as much free space as possible around the pressure relief mechanism. In the event of an incident, this allows pressure to escape in multiple directions and dissipate in a controlled manner.
This design protects not only the extraction system itself but also the adjacent production area. Especially when dealing with explosive metal grinding dust, this unobstructed relief area is a crucial part of the safety concept. The pressure relief system, rupture disc, fire suppression system, sensors, and control system are coordinated with one another and designed for the specific material being extracted.
Level Monitoring and Retractable VA Debris Container
The waste disposal system was also integrated into the security and surveillance concept of the EP 28 PROTECT . A fill-level sensor detects when the container reaches a critical fill level and automatically transmits this information to the system control unit.
This allows for an early response before operational disruptions or unsafe conditions arise. Monitoring thus not only supports process safety but also ensures the predictable and controlled disposal of the extracted material.
The debris container is made of sturdy VA stainless steel and can be lowered for removal. Thanks to the integrated swivel casters , it can be easily rolled out of the system after being lowered . This simplifies the disposal of the extracted metal dust and reduces the manual effort required when changing the container.
This solution offers a significant advantage, particularly when dealing with safety-critical dusts: The container can be removed in a controlled, ergonomic manner with minimal material movement. This simplifies maintenance and facilitates the safe handling of the collected material.
Tight System Shutdown
The system is equipped with sturdy quick-release fasteners. These allow the housing components to be opened and closed quickly, but can also be adjusted manually.
This is important to ensure that the system remains leak-free over the long term. Especially when dealing with fine grinding dust and safety-critical applications, sealing must not be left to chance.
Compressed Air Cleaning with Interval and Follow-Up Cleaning
An automatic compressed-air cleaning system is integrated to ensure consistently reliable operation. The filters are cleaned at set intervals. In addition, a post-cleaning function is provided so that dust can still be removed from the filter even after the unit has stopped running.
This reduces maintenance requirements and helps ensure consistent suction power over extended periods of use.

Check valve
The system is also equipped with a check valve.
It serves as an additional protective component within the system design and helps ensure a safe separation between the process and the exhaust system.
If the check valve is triggered, it sends a signal to the system control via an interface. The system is then automatically shut down.
PID Control with Flow Rate Regulation
The heart of the EP 28 PROTECT is the integrated PID controller with flow rate control. It connects the individual safety and system components into a coordinated overall system and ensures that the extraction system not only operates at high performance but also continuously monitors and actively controls the process .
The extraction capacity is not set at a fixed level but is controlled based on the process. Especially in grinding processes involving flammable metal dusts, a stable flow rate is crucial to ensure that the dust generated is reliably captured and safely removed. The control system continuously monitors the system’s status and adjusts the extraction capacity to meet the requirements of the customer’s process.
The control system integrates several key functions of the system: airflow control, filter cleaning, fill level monitoring, the fire suppression system, automatic shutdown in the event of a fire, and other safety functions. As a result, the components do not operate in isolation from one another but are specifically coordinated during operation.
A particular advantage lies in the process-oriented design. The control system was tailored to the specific grinding process and the medium to be extracted. The result is a solution that not only adapts technically to the application but can also be integrated into the customer’s existing production and safety systems.
This brings the EP 28 PROTECT into a customized, comprehensive solution: The system automatically detects, monitors, controls, and responds to defined operating conditions. This increases process reliability, ensures consistent extraction performance, and guarantees that safety functions are triggered in a controlled manner in the event of an incident.
Custom Machine Building Instead of Standard Solutions
The EVOTEC EP 28 PROTECT demonstrates what an extraction system can look like when it is precisely tailored to a specific process. For combustible metal grinding dusts, it’s not just the airflow rate, filter area, and motor power that matter. What’s crucial is the overall concept, which includes process integration, safety features, controls, and ease of maintenance.
This is precisely where the strength of custom machine building lies: The system is not cobbled together around the process, but is designed from the outset to suit the specific application.

For processes involving flammable or explosive dusts, a case-by-case assessment is crucial. The material, dust behavior, process control, installation location, and safety requirements must all be evaluated together. Only then can an extraction solution be developed that is technically suitable and functions reliably during operation.
